| Criteria | Low-Risk Population * | High-Risk Population ** |
|---|---|---|
| Major Criteria | Carditis (clinical and subclinical) | Carditis (clinical and subclinical) |
| Polyarthritis | Mono-/polyarthritis/polyarthralgia | |
| Chorea | Chorea | |
| Erythema marginatum | Erythema marginatum | |
| Subcutaneous nodules | Subcutaneous nodules | |
| Minor Criteria | Polyarthralgia | Monoarthralgia |
| Fever (≥38.5 °C) | Fever (≥38 °C) | |
| ESR ≥ 60 mm/h or CRP ≥ 3.0 mg/dL | ESR ≥ 30 mm/h or CRP ≥ 3.0 mg/dL | |
| Prolonged PQ interval | Prolonged PQ interval |
| Clinical Setting | Duration Since Last Episode | Level of Evidence |
|---|---|---|
| Rheumatic fever with carditis and residual heart disease (persistent valve disease *) | 10 years or until the age of 40 (whichever is longer) | IC |
| Rheumatic fever with carditis without residual heart disease | 10 years or until the age of 21 (whichever is longer) | IC |
| Rheumatic fever without carditis | 5 years or until the age of 21 (whichever is longer) | IC |
| Preparation | Dosing | Application | Level of Evidence |
|---|---|---|---|
| Benzathine penicillin G | 0.6 million units ≤ 27 kg; 1.2 million units > 27 kg every four weeks * | intramuscularly | IA |
| Penicillin V | 250 mg twice daily | orally | IB |
| Sulfadiazines | 500 mg daily ≤ 27 kg; 1000 mg daily > 27 kg | orally | IB |
| In case of penicillin and sulfadiazine allergy | |||
| Macrolides or azalides | variable | orally | IC |
| Diagnosis | Symptoms | Pathophysiology | Therapy |
|---|---|---|---|
| Septic arthritis | usually monoarthritic, arthralgia, fever | bacterial joint infection with systemic seeding | antibiotic therapy, debridement (if necessary), arthrotomy |
| Gout | acute: mono- to polyarthritis, fever; chronic: soft tissue and bone tophi, urate nephropathy | precipitation of urate crystals, activation of the inflammasome complex | acute: NSAIDs, colchicine, corticosteroids, cryotherapy |
| Acute rheumatic fever | fever, arthralgia, arthritis, carditis, Sydenham’s chorea, subcutaneous nodules, erythema marginatum | autoimmune reaction in cross-reactions between streptococcal antigens and tissue antigens | penicillin, ASA and corticosteroids, antibiotic recurrence prophylaxis |
| Rheumatoid arthritis | peripheral polyarthritis, non-specific general symptoms, extra-articular organ manifestations | autoimmune disease induces inflammatory synovialitis | physical therapy, immunosuppressants, biologics, NSAIDs |
| Lyme arthritis | (mono-) arthritis, other possible manifestations: encephalomyelitis, erythema migrans, meningoradiculitis Bannwarth, myocarditis | Borrelia burgdorferi sensu lato infection | Doxycyclin, amoxicillin or Cefotaxim |
| Systemic lupus erythematosus | polyarthritis, myositis, skin changes, serositis, neurological involvement, lupus nephritis | immunological systemic disease with impaired activity of T and B cells, complement activation | NSAIDs, hydroxychloroquine, corticosteroids, belimumab, MTX, azathioprine, rituximab |
| Reactive arthritis | Reiter’s Trias: arthritis, urethritis, conjunctivitis, dactylitis, uveitis, general symptoms | post-infectious autoimmune reaction after enteric infection or urethritis | infection remediation, symptomatic: physical therapy, NSAIDs, corticosteroids |
| Adult Still’s disease | salmon-colored, small- spotted maculopapular rash, fever, myalgias/arthralgias, symmetrical polyarthritis, sore throat, lung and heart involvement | autoimmune disease, exact pathophysiology unknown | steroids, MTX, IL-1 and IL-6 blockade, TNF blockade, immunoglobulins |
| Arthritis/arthralgia in viral infections | arthritides/arthralgias, general symptoms, virus-specific complaints | infection with Hepatitis B/C, HIV, parvovirus B19, Chikungunya, Zika virus, Rubella | virus-dependent, symptomatic and sometimes specific antiviral therapy |
